Our Journey ShopBack began in 2014 as a late-night spark of inspiration between Henry and Joel — not just to build a Cashback platform, but to reimagine how brands and consumers connect. As former advertisers, they understood the limitations of traditional marketing, and saw an opportunity to deliver more value on both sides. That idea quickly turned into action, and the first prototype was built over a weekend with the other co-founders. Today, ShopBack serves over 50 million users across 13 markets, partners with 20,000+ merchants, and powers over half a million transactions daily. Responsibilities:

  • Assist in the execution and planning of marketing campaigns, including creating design briefs, copywriting, and scheduling of assets across all marketing channels
  • Contribute in brainstorming of ideas to create new and impactful campaigns that resonate with our users
  • Investigate and proactively resolve any issues with campaigns that have gone live
  • Optimise platform assets and analyse website performance and data on a regular basis and sharing key insights and learnings with the internal marketing team
  • If proven capable, there will be opportunities to run campaigns independently end-to-end before the end of internship
  • This role is based in Malaysia, and will be responsible for campaigns in both Singapore and Malaysia.

Requirements:

  • Able to commit for 6 months ideally
  • Strong sense of responsibility
  • Meticulous and able to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Proactive and takes the initiative to solve issues fast
  • Positive work attitude with good communication skills
  • Responsive and fast worker
